How to Make We Re Going Bananas Bread
- Grease and flour a 10-inch bundt pan or two 9x5-inch loaf pans.
- In a large bowl, cream together 1 cup (2 sticks) of softened unsalted butter and 1 ¾ cups granulated sugar until light and fluffy.
- Beat in 4 large eggs, one at a time, then stir in 1 teaspoon vanilla extract.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together 3 cups all-purpose flour, 1 teaspoon baking soda, 1 teaspoon salt, and ½ teaspoon ground cinnamon.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ined. Do not overmix.
- Mash 3 ripe bananas with a fork. Add them to the batter along with 1 cup chopped walnuts or pecans (optional).
- Stir in 1 cup raisins or chocolate chips (optional).
- Pour batter into the prepared pan(s) and spread evenly.
- Bake in a preheated 350°F (175°C) oven for 60-70 minutes, or until a wooden skewer inserted into the center comes out clean.
- Let the bread cool in the pan for 10-15 minutes before inverting it onto a wire rack to cool completely.
